Take A Sneek Look At Google Trends for Websites
After a lot of guessing and debating, Google has launched its own version of traffic analysis in the line of alexa, compete, quantcast et al. Google calls it “Google Trends for Websites”. There’s a high speculation from where the data comes – Google toolbar or Google Analytics or both.
